How can businesses measure the impact of empathy and active listening training on employee performance and customer satisfaction levels, and what strategies can they implement to continuously improve and enhance these skills within their organization?
Businesses can measure the impact of empathy and active listening training on employee performance and customer satisfaction levels through surveys, feedback from employees and customers, and tracking key performance indicators related to communication and customer service. To continuously improve and enhance these skills within their organization, businesses can implement regular training sessions, provide opportunities for practice and feedback, encourage open communication and empathy in the workplace culture, and reward and recognize employees who demonstrate strong empathy and active listening skills. Additionally, businesses can create a supportive environment where employees feel empowered to use these skills effectively in their interactions with both colleagues and customers.
